Artisan Small Cap Fund's Investment Approach

Artisan Partners, an investment management company, released its fourth-quarter 2025 investor letter for Artisan Small Cap Fund. The letter highlights the rationale behind the fund's decision to trim its holdings in Lattice Semiconductor (LSCC). This strategic move reflects broader market trends and the fund's commitment to optimizing its portfolio.
